Transaction 331ef19f74a0492dc4a2822e873f3ab6870bee0b06e8f1e10d81a372562f3064
1 Input
2 Outputs
- 331ef19f74a0492dc4a2822e873f3ab6870bee0b06e8f1e10d81a372562f3064:0
- 331ef19f74a0492dc4a2822e873f3ab6870bee0b06e8f1e10d81a372562f3064:1
value 3654963
address 1Ackh5czEwd6wUGcKbHBEycWdgg88Nydcm
value 1500000
address 1PW21MuBgPnjfUQriwK7TnRADFotEhdysr